On Dec 13, 4:26 pm, rfx_labs <[email protected]> wrote:
> this is the patch for this:
>
> @@ -151,7 +151,7 @@
>          return 'Random()'
>      def NOT_NULL(self,default):
>          return 'NOT NULL DEFAULT %s' % default
> -    def SUBSTRING(self,fieldname,pos,lenght):
> +    def SUBSTRING(self,fieldname,pos,length):
>          return 'SUBSTR(%s,%s,%s)' % (fieldname, pos, length)
>      def PRIMARY_KEY(self,key):
>          return 'PRIMARY KEY(%s)' % key
> @@ -386,7 +386,7 @@
>          }
>      def RANDOM(self):
>          return 'RAND()'
> -    def SUBSTRING(self,fieldname,pos,lenght):
> +    def SUBSTRING(self,fieldname,pos,length):
>          return 'SUBSTRING(%s,%s,%s)' % (fieldname, pos, length)
>      def DROP(self,table,mode):
>          # breaks db integrity but without this mysql does not drop
> table
> @@ -605,7 +605,7 @@
>          return 'LEFT OUTER JOIN'
>      def RANDOM(self):
>          return 'NEWID()'
> -    def SUBSTRING(self,fieldname,pos,lenght):
> +    def SUBSTRING(self,fieldname,pos,length):
>          return 'SUBSTRING(%s,%s,%s)' % (fieldname, pos, length)
>      def PRIMARY_KEY(self,key):
>          return 'PRIMARY KEY CLUSTERED (%s)' % key
> @@ -731,7 +731,7 @@
>          return 'RAND()'
>      def NOT_NULL(self,default):
>          return 'DEFAULT %s NOT NULL', default
> -    def SUBSTRING(self,fieldname,pos,lenght):
> +    def SUBSTRING(self,fieldname,pos,length):
>          return 'SUBSTRING(%s,%s,%s)' % (fieldname, pos, length)
>      def DROP(self,table,mode):
>          return ['DROP TABLE %s %s;' % (table, mode), 'DROP GENERATOR
> GENID_%s;' % table]
> @@ -2738,8 +2738,8 @@
>      def __getslice__(self, start, stop):
>          if start < 0 or stop < start:
>              raise SyntaxError, 'not supported: %s - %s' % (start,
> stop)
> -        d = dict(field=str(self), pos=start + 1, length=stop - start)
> -        s = self._db._adapter.SUBSTRING(d)
> +        d = dict(fieldname=str(self), pos=start + 1, length=stop -
> start)
> +        s = self._db._adapter.SUBSTRING(**d)
>          return Expression(s, 'string', self._db)
>
>      def __getitem__(self, i):
